Do I need to go to court for this matter?
Most Deceased Estates matters in Woollahra, NSW are resolved through the probate process without requiring a court appearance. However, disputes between beneficiaries, contested wills, or challenges to the validity of an estate can necessitate tribunal or court involvement to reach resolution. A lawyer can advise whether court involvement is required and which court or tribunal applies to your situation.

How much do Deceased Estates lawyers cost in Woollahra, NSW?
Deceased estates lawyers in Woollahra, NSW typically charge between $300 and $600 per hour. These hourly rates vary based on the lawyer's experience, location and the firm, though the total cost of your matter depends on how much time is required. Straightforward estate administration where beneficiaries agree and assets are simple may require fewer hours and therefore cost less overall. Matters involving disputed wills or complex asset valuations often take more time, while contested estates requiring formal court proceedings demand significantly more preparation and result in higher total costs. Actual fees vary depending on the lawyer and the circumstances of the matter.

What documents do I need for a Deceased Estates lawyer in Woollahra, NSW?
Bringing together relevant paperwork before meeting with a Deceased Estates lawyer in Woollahra, NSW can streamline your initial consultation significantly. If available, it can help to have the death certificate, the deceased's will (if one exists), probate documents, bank statements, property deeds, superannuation details, and insurance policies ready for review. You may be asked to provide identification documents and any correspondence with financial institutions or government agencies.
